DIVING: The Galapagos Islands scuba diving experience was chosen by Rodale’s Scuba Diving (www.scubadiving.com) as the world’s top all around diving experience for the year 2000. Galapagos was chosen as the top spot in “Best Fish Life”, “Best Big Animal Dive”, “Best Advanced Diving” and scored among the top as the “Healthiest Marine Environment”, and “Best Value”. The waters around these islands are a paradise for divers who will surely encounter hammerheads, giant manta rays, whale sharks and many other marvelous creatures.

Alta is one of the most beautiful ships in all of Galapagos, ideal for those seeking exclusivity, style and uniqueness. It is very stylish, with exceptional detailing and furnishings, and carries that special charm of a sailing ship. When the conditions are appropriate, the sails will be hoisted and Alta will become one the most striking ships in the Galapagos.

Capacity: 16 guests in 8 cabins plus 8 crew members and 1 naturalist guide.

Public Areas: Alta features a comfortable salon for lectures and presentations; TV/Video system; Inside and Al Fresco Dinning Areas; a sundeck with lounge chairs, and a resting area at the stern of the ship.

Meals: Served in either the inside Dinning Room or the Al Fresco Dinning area when climate permits. Breakfast, lunch, and dinner are served buffet style and prepared by our specially trained chefs. Meals are served in wholesome quantities and in a variety of menus with tropical exotic fruits always available. Kids menus and vegetarian menus are also available upon request.

Cabins: All cabins have exceptional accommodations, private facilities, climate controls and ample space to hang and store clothing.

Special Features: Ample outside space. Sea kayaks, snorkeling gear, wetsuits.

Special Features for Children: Special Kids Club with activities like star-gazing and movie nights. Child-oriented guides who organize learning activities and provide children with a kids expedition journal are placed specifically for departures with children. Wide range of board games and movies for children. Kids Menus specially prepared for family departures.

Departures: Alta is outfitted for individual passengers or private charters, family departures and departures for more active groups which involve more kayaking, snorkeling and hiking.

Safety: Alta abides under all international standards of safety for a ship of its type. It is ISM certified and is equipped with an emergency alarm system, 2 emergency life rafts for 16 pax each, emergency life vests, fog horns, smoke detectors, and fire extinguishers. All emergency equipment is SOLAS certified.

Navigation Equipment: Sperry Gyrocompass, Furuno 21 mile Si-tex radar, Robertson AP 7 autopilot, GPS satellite navigator, forward looking echo sounder, NVI Instruments, depthfinders, Decca Navigator, Si-tex video sonar

Safety Equipment: EPIRB (Emergency Position Indicating Radio Beacon), 2 x 18 person Vicking open sea life rafts, life jackets, flares and signals, fire extinguishing system. In short, safety equipment on board either meets or exceeds USA Coast Guard Regulations.

Comfort Equipment: 1200 gal/day watermaker, air-conditioning throughout, icemaker, stereo, TV, VCR

Communication Equipment: Furuno single sideband radio, VHF radio, SSB radio

Electricity: 110 volts AC / 60 Hz

Type: Three-Masted Staysail Schooner

L.O.A.: 140 feet / 46 meters

Beam: 21 feet / 6.8 meters

Engines: 4 cylinder Alpha Diesel, 280 BHP. One 1500 puond thrust Arcturus bowthruster

Generators: 2 x 35 KVA John Deere

Builder: Titleness, Norway

Speed: 9 knots under power
